What rights do you have as a hotel guest?

A guest has a right to remain in the hotel for a reasonable time. Upon the expiration of the rental period, a hotel guest has no right to use the room. S/he also loses any privacy interest associated with the room.

How important is the guest satisfaction for the hotel future?

It has been demonstrated that satisfaction is closely related to their willingness to return to the hotel, so it is an essential condition of loyalty. When service quality is increasing, not only the level of satisfaction grows but also the customer value which more closely influence the intention to return.

How often does a hotel walk a guest?

The term “walking a guest” sends shivers down any manager’s spine. Since the average no-show rate is 10 percent daily, hotels will overbook whenever possible. The sales and reservations departments are encouraged to book the property to 110 percent capacity, in the hopes that with cancellations and no-shows they will fill every room.

What should you not leave in a hotel room?

Most hotel rooms provide an easy-to-use safe, so you might as well take advantage: Don’t leave your precious jewels, wallets, or purses in your room, unless it’s in a hotel-provided safe, says a Farmers Insurance Group representative.
